1625 (ca.), Peter Paul Rubens, Portrait of Susanna Lunden (?) ("Le Chapeau de Paille") -- National Gallery (London)
From the museum label: The subject of this enchanting portrait is thought to be Susanna Lunden, daughter of the Antwerp silk merchant Daniel Fourment, and sister of Rubens's second wife, Hélène. The painting probably dates from shortly after her marriage to Arnold Lunden in 1622.
